This patch initializes the VT-d Posted-Interrupts Descriptor.

Signed-off-by: Feng Wu <feng...@intel.com>
---
 arch/x86/kvm/vmx.c | 27 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++
 1 file changed, 27 insertions(+)

diff --git a/arch/x86/kvm/vmx.c b/arch/x86/kvm/vmx.c
index 0b1383e..66ca275 100644
--- a/arch/x86/kvm/vmx.c
+++ b/arch/x86/kvm/vmx.c
@@ -45,6 +45,7 @@
 #include <asm/perf_event.h>
 #include <asm/debugreg.h>
 #include <asm/kexec.h>
+#include <asm/irq_remapping.h>
 
 #include "trace.h"
 
@@ -4433,6 +4434,30 @@ static void ept_set_mmio_spte_mask(void)
        kvm_mmu_set_mmio_spte_mask((0x3ull << 62) | 0x6ull);
 }
 
+static void pi_desc_init(struct vcpu_vmx *vmx)
+{
+       unsigned int dest;
+
+       if (!irq_remapping_cap(IRQ_POSTING_CAP))
+               return;
+
+       /*
+        * Initialize Posted-Interrupt Descriptor
+        */
+
+       pi_clear_sn(&vmx->pi_desc);
+       vmx->pi_desc.nv = POSTED_INTR_VECTOR;
+
+       /* Physical mode for Notificaiton Event */
+       vmx->pi_desc.ndm = 0;
+       dest = cpu_physical_id(vmx->vcpu.cpu);
+
+       if (x2apic_enabled())
+               vmx->pi_desc.ndst = dest;
+       else
+               vmx->pi_desc.ndst = (dest << 8) & 0xFF00;
+}
+
 /*
  * Sets up the vmcs for emulated real mode.
  */
@@ -4476,6 +4501,8 @@ static int vmx_vcpu_setup(struct vcpu_vmx *vmx)
 
                vmcs_write64(POSTED_INTR_NV, POSTED_INTR_VECTOR);
                vmcs_write64(POSTED_INTR_DESC_ADDR, __pa((&vmx->pi_desc)));
+
+               pi_desc_init(vmx);
        }
